Respiratory Tract Neoplasms

Source:http://linkedlifedata.com/resource/umls/id/C0035244

CSP: new abnormal tissue of the respiratory system that grows by excessive cellular division and proliferation more rapidly than normal and continues to grow after the stimuli that initiated the new growth cease; use when broadly discussing the tubular and cavernous organs and structures in which pulmonary ventilation and gas exchange between ambient air and the blood are brought about.,NCI: A benign or malignant, primary or metastatic neoplasm involving the respiratory tract.
